Dallas Mavericks Launch Dogecoin Rewards Program: Mavs Cryptomania

Welcome to Mavs Cryptomania

The Dallas Mavericks are stepping up their game, not only on the basketball court but also in the ever-evolving world of digital currencies. Mark Cuban, the franchise’s owner and a vocal advocate for cryptocurrency, has introduced a cash-back rewards initiative named Mavs Cryptomania. This program aims to incentivize fans to purchase merchandise and tickets using Dogecoin (DOGE), adding a futuristic twist to the fan experience.

How Does It Work?

Here’s the scoop: fans who spend over $150 in a single transaction using DOGE will receive an enticing $25 e-gift card redeemable for online shopping in the Dallas Mavericks’ store. It’s as if your Dogecoin is not just a meme but also a ticket to sweet swag. To underline the power of this currency, you’ll need to spend around 505 DOGE to score that gift card.

The Timeline

This promotional adventure is set to run until September 30. So, whether you need a jersey or want to deck out your gameday look, it’s time to leverage your Dogecoin. If you played it right with your crypto transactions, this is your chance for a little redemption — literally.

Mark Cuban and His Crypto Vision

Mark Cuban isn’t just throwing money into the world of crypto; he’s diving in headfirst. In addition to spearheading this program, Cuban has actively backed various crypto projects, and he’s been on record saying that Dogecoin is evolving into a legitimate digital currency. He believes it’s not just another joke meme, despite its origins, and has revealed that Mavs merchandise sales via DOGE have surpassed the totals seen when accepting Bitcoin (BTC) or Ethereum (ETH).

Taking a Stand against FUD

Recently, Cuban pushed back against criticism of cryptocurrencies, especially from notable figures like Donald Trump. In a fiery exchange, he urged observers to see crypto assets not just as currency but as revolutionary platforms underpinning a plethora of applications. Cuban’s bold statement encourages a broader understanding of digital currencies: they’re much more than their cash equivalents; they’re technology-driven solutions ready for future innovation.

A Shared Skepticism

Senior NBA analyst Bill Ingram expressed concerns about the stability and value of cryptocurrencies, comparing them to something imaginary. However, Cuban’s retort directed focus back to the underlying technology rather than the speculative nature of the assets themselves.
